Greensboro Bend has something in store for you whenever you visit. January is the coldest month of the year, while July is hottest, with average temperatures up to 66.2 degrees Fahrenheit. The wettest month in Greensboro Bend is June, so pack accordingly.
![]() | ![]() | ![]() | ![]() |
January | 15.6°F (-9.1°C) | Light Rain | Very Cloudy |
February | 18.0°F (-7.8°C) | Light Rain | Very Cloudy |
March | 26.6°F (-3.0°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
April | 39.2°F (4.0°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
May | 53.1°F (11.7°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
June | 60.4°F (15.8°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
July | 66.2°F (19.0°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
August | 64.4°F (18.0°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
September | 57.6°F (14.2°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
October | 45.9°F (7.7°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
November | 33.1°F (0.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
December | 23.4°F (-4.8°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y |
